$300,000 salary in Ohio
A single filer earning $300,000 in Ohio takes home $207,363 in 2026, $8,640 per semi-monthly paycheck, after $68,134 in federal income tax, $7,813 in Ohio income tax and $16,689 in Social Security and Medicare: an effective tax rate of 30.9%. Ohio has a progressive income tax topping out at 2.75%. Married filing jointly on the same single income, take-home is $226,532 (24.5% effective).
